Studies involving freeze-dried methyl linolenate-gelatin foams indicate that the extent of lipid-protein interaction corresponds to the degree of autoxidation of the lipid fraction. This document contains a summary of changes in administrations and actions taken by the Pacific Marine Fisheries Commission in 1965, as well as an update for the status of various fisheries.
This issue of the PMFC bulletin focuses primarily on the English sole, including results of tagging off of various coasts and studies of various populations of English sole. It also gives a review of sablefish tagging in California and details the Oregon trawl fishery for mink food up to 1965.
This issue of the bulletin covers salmon landings, spawning of dover sole, movements of petrale sole, the pink shrimp fishery, and availability of small salmon off the Columbia River.
